605 W. Oglethorpe Avenue, location of the recently opened Embassy Suites Savannah, will soon be home to “Rue” Savannah. Holy City Hospitality has expanded its list of fine restaurants in the Lowcountry by opening 4 new banners this year, making “Rue” Savannah a happy number five.
Widely known simply as “Rue”, this Downtown eatery has been abuzz since opening its doors in 2001. Rue is inspired by the style of classic French Brasseries, the impeccable flavor and European design will lend an air of sophisticated comfort. Rue’s menu incorporates classic French staples with contemporary fare. Sample mussels in your choice of six different preparations followed by Steak Au Poivre, or savor our famous burger, ground in-house and served alongside hand-cut pommes frites.
“39 Rue de Jean has become a favorite meeting spot of both locals and visitors in our flagship Charleston location and we are honored to join the Savannah Community to offer a dining destination for both leisurely lunches and lively dinners,” explains Holy City Hospitality Operator Daren Wolfe. “Savannah is rich with vibrant life and history, and we are excited to be coming to town early this fall.”
Holy City Hospitality’s other ventures include Charleston’s 39 Rue de Jean, Virginia’s on King, Coast Bar and Grill, Vincent Chicco’s, Victor Social Club, Michael’s on the Alley, The Islander and Good Food Catering.
With multiple concepts, and proven hospitality, Holy City Hospitality is excited to announce the next step in growing their family of fine restaurants to Savannah, Georgia.
